Association between the rs7583431 single nucleotide polymorphism close to the activating transcription factor 2 gene and the analgesic effect of fentanyl in the cold pain test.
Neuropsychopharmacology reports - 1 Jun 2018
Aoki Yoshinori, Nishizawa Daisuke, Yoshida Kaori, Hasegawa Junko, Kasai Shinya, Takahashi Kaori, Koukita Yoshihiko, Ichinohe Tatsuya, Hayashida Masakazu, Fukuda Ken-Ichi, Ikeda Kazutaka
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Activating transcription factor 2 (ATF2) is a member of the leucine zipper family of DNA binding proteins and is widely distributed in tissues. Several recent studies have demonstrated that this protein is involved in mechanisms that are related to pain and inflammation. However, unclear is whether polymorphisms of the ATF2 gene, which encodes the human ATF2 protein, influence pain or analgesic...
